All,
I have looked at the orbit 218 ATS,
IBEX_2013_240_o0218a_v001.scr,
and I approve.
There are no constraint violations in
IBEX_2013_240_o0218a_v001.ccvr.
The PL commands in the v001 ATS match those in the v002 STF,
IBEX_2013_240_o0218a_v002.stf.
Ascending and descending command sequences are consistent with each other and 15 Re ascending, the apogee maneuver time and 15 Re descending as determined from the OEF file,
IBEX_2013_240_o0218a_v001.oef,
and as verified with ibex_orbit.
There is one star tracker outage. It starts about 45 minutes before perigee and ends about 4 1/2 hours after perigee. No despinning should be required due to this outage.
There is one short moon in Lo FOV session in arc A. The session is only about 48 minutes long and the start and stop events do not appear in the OEF.
The ground station command sequences are correct and the timing and bit rates match those in the contacts file,
IBEX_Orbit218Contacts.txt,
for all contacts (2).
We are doing battery cell balancing this orbit and the balancing commands are correct and offset by enough time from other commands.
The inertial maneuver at perigee of orbit 217 left us pointing in safe directions for orbit 218 arc A ascending and descending sequences:
